Report: Oversight Contributed to Falcon Airplane Crash

Oversight and “unintentional errors” by crew and ground handlers may have contributed to an airplane crash that caused “tens of thousands” of euros in damages, investigators have found.

A Falcon 7X aircraft broke free from its parking position in December 2017, ploughing through a perimeter fence and into the road before crashing into a building owned by Polidano Group. The plane’s nose, including the cockpit, ended up inside the building.
